Re: upm_file_packets
feature request:
- sort order – I think at the moment it lists multiple files alphabetically? an option to sort according to the order specified in the custom field (33,37,31) would be great … or maybe I’m missing something
- on the files tab, how about a checkbox next to each file (default: ticked) that determines whether the file is publicly available? reason being: sometimes you want to keep notice of ‘historical’ files – and display them (with a txp-inserted class perhaps) maybe crossed out… I’m thinking for a mp3 blog where I’d like to remove files after a certain time but would like the relevant articles to show what files were provided… I think it would make sense for other applications too… (and if you want to delete the damn thing, just hit the ‘x’!)
No.2 may be out of plugin scope so will cross post on ‘feature request’ forum

Re: upm_file_packets
- The tag works identical to the built-in, so it sorts by filename alphabetically by default, and you can also order by download count (asc or desc) or “random”. I agree custom, sort order should be possible. So it shall be written, so it shall be done. ;)
- While it could be done with a plugin, it would mean either altering the textpattern table, or creating a new one. Neither of which I’d choose to do if I can avoid it. It’d be a lot cleaner – and make more sense – to have that kind of feature built-in to Textpattern.
